ADVANCE LIMIT Clause Samples
The Advance Limit clause sets a maximum cap on the amount of funds or credit that can be advanced to a party under an agreement. In practice, this means that even if additional funds are requested or needed, the advancing party is not obligated to provide more than the specified limit. This clause is commonly used in loan agreements or revolving credit facilities to control financial exposure and manage risk. Its core function is to protect the lender or provider by ensuring that their total liability does not exceed a predetermined amount, thereby preventing overextension of credit.

ADVANCE LIMIT. (Section 1.1) An amount not to exceed the lesser of $45,000,000 (“Maximum Discretionary Line Amount”) or the sum of (a) and (b) below:
(a) 85% of the net amount of Client’s Eligible Receivables (as defined in Section 8 above); plus
(b) the lesser of (i) 50% of the value of Client’s Eligible Inventory (as defined in Section 8 above) and (ii) 85% of the net orderly liquidation value (as determined by an independent third-party inventory appraisal acceptable to ▇▇▇▇▇ Fargo Century), which is located at Client’s Address, ▇▇▇▇ ▇.▇. ▇▇▇▇ ▇▇▇▇▇▇, ▇▇▇▇▇ [Dorel], Florida and at any other location where ▇▇▇▇▇ Fargo Century has received a signed collateral access agreement in form and substance acceptable to it; provided that the amount under this subsection 1(b) shall not exceed the lesser of (i) 30% of total Advances outstanding at any given time, and (ii) $8,000,000. “Value” of Client’s Eligible Inventory shall mean the lower of cost or wholesale market value thereof, as determined by ▇▇▇▇▇ Fargo Century in its sole discretion.
(c) based on the formula set forth in (b) above, the initial advance rates against Inventory by product type as of the date hereof are: Very Kool 20.0% LG 50.0% Samsung 50.0% Other Brands 30.00%
